No sooner had Kaizer Chiefs touched down in Mzansi from their trip to Zambia where they defeated ZESCO United 1-0 in a TotalEnergies CAF Confederation Cup Group D match, they were heading to Bloemfontein for Wednesday’s Betway Premiership encounter against Marumo Gallants.

With Chiefs firmly in the league title race with half of the season remaining, www.kaizerchiefs.com caught up with gifted attacker, Mfundo Vilakazi, to hear his thoughts on Amakhosi’s current form and busy schedule ahead.

They also boosted their chances of qualifying for the knockout rounds of the Confed Cup with a disciplined, no-frills performance that secured a great result against ZESCO on Sunday.

“The three points were important for us even though we couldn’t play our football due to the bumpy pitch, but we adapted well enough to get the win,” the 20-year-old says of the game.

With one job done, another looms immediately into view and Vilakazi and his teammates have to swiftly shift focus to their next assignment.

“Because of the AFCON break, there’s very little time between games but as players we have to adjust to the situation and get on with it,” says Vilakazi philosophically, adding, “As a player, I am just looking to help the team because everyone is going to have to contribute. I think the most important thing in these conditions is to get some rest between matches.”

Their opponents on Wednesday, Marumo Gallants seem to reserve their better performances for facing the big teams but for Vilakazi executing their own game plan will be the decisive factor in the outcome.

“I believe that if we play our football, the results will come. It will be nice to get another three points away from home,” he says, noting that he scored away to Gallants last season.

“It crossed my mind, and I think I’d like to do it again,” he concludes with a broad smile.
